Apice, Italy ( GHOST CITY ) – Everyone Left And Didn’t Return
Once a popular tourist destination in Italy, Apice is a historic town with architectural beauty and rich legacy. But the 1980 Irpinia earthquake permanently changed the terrain of the town, resulting in 25,000 displaced persons and 2,500 fatalities.
